Description

Janka Fully Cooked Apricot Pierogi Ingredients: DOUGH: Blended Flour (Wheat Flour, Malted Barley Flour, Niacin, Iron, Potassium Bromate, Thiamine Mononitrate, Riboflavin), Water, Whole Milk, Eggs, Dried Potatoes (Color and Flavor Protected with Sodium Bisulfate, Citric Acid and BHT), Oleomargarine (Liquid Soybean Oil, Partially Hydrogenated Soybean Oil, Water, Salt, Vegetable Lecithin, Vegetable Mono and Diglycerides, Whey Citric Acid, Calcium Disodium EDTA and Sodium Benzoate as preservatives. Artificially Flavored, Colored with Carotene, Vitamin A Palmitate Added), Salt, Sugar. FILLING: Sugar Syrup, Apricots prepared with Sulphur, Corn Syrup, Vegetable Stabilizer. FD & C Yellow #6.

Hazard / Reason

Food recall due to misbranding/incorrect labeling of Janka Apricot Pierogies. Yellow #5 not included on label of final product.

Class II: Product that may cause temporary or medically reversible health consequences.

Class II indicates the product may cause temporary or medically reversible health effects. The probability of serious harm is considered remote.
